Студопедия.Орг Главная | Случайная страница | Контакты | Мы поможем в написании вашей работы!  
 

Разработка утилиты резервного копирования



У каждого пользователя ПК существует большое количество собственных наработок, документов, фотографий, потеря которых крайне нежелательна. Но потеря может произойти по многим причинам, например: крах ОС и файловой системы, физическая поломка или утрата накопителя, в результате действий вредоносного ПО.
Для сохранения данных пользователя необходимо выполнять резервное копирование данных. Для автоматизации данного процесса используются утилиты резервного копирования.

Требуется разработать программу, которая в указанное пользователем время будет создавать резервную копию указанных пользователем данных (каталоги, файлы). Резервная копия должна помещаться в указанное место (общедоступная сетевая папка, внешний накопитель, и т.д.). Программа должна иметь возможность сохранения нескольких резервных копий, должна иметь возможность создания полной копии (когда копируются все вложенные каталоги и файлы), или инкрементной копии (когда сохраняются только измененные и новые каталоги и файлы с момента последней резервной копии). Инкрементная копия используется для сокращения необходимого места. Программа должна иметь возможность запуска в ручном режиме по команде пользователя, или в автоматическом режиме, работая по заданному пользователем расписанию.





Дата публикования: 2015-10-09; Прочитано: 167 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!



studopedia.org - Студопедия.Орг - 2014-2024 год. Студопедия не является автором материалов, которые размещены. Но предоставляет возможность бесплатного использования (0.006 с)...